OP Gymsters fare well on Long Island

The Orchard Park Gymsters, who train at Gymnastics Unlimited, turned in multiple gold-medal performances at the recently held Early New York State Championship Meet on Long Island.

As a team, the Gymsters were one of the squads with the most banners, as the Level 4 gymnasts placed second, the Level 6 gymnasts placed third and the Level 5 gymnast took sixth.

The Gymsters’ boys contingent, meanwhile, competed at a large invitational in Syracuse the same weekend. As a team, the Gymsters earned fourth at Level 5 and ninth at Level 4.

At Level 4, Orchard Park’s John Carroccia took first on high bar, rings and all around (86.6), as well as second on parallel bars, third on pommel horse, and fourth on vault and floor.
